Transaction d324c79505eb6dca138eb8adb83ac178ad2736e58c69a7e4570500ff8027772a
1 Input
2 Outputs
- d324c79505eb6dca138eb8adb83ac178ad2736e58c69a7e4570500ff8027772a:0
- d324c79505eb6dca138eb8adb83ac178ad2736e58c69a7e4570500ff8027772a:1
value 620783
address mzEW9cWzhZ4ubJEAYoPfriPsByVJXdnUqb
value 100000
address mnnVrpDyoRaT7hUA39WaMYm5KkAjTrGH5c